Methodology: How We Ranked the Best Solar Companies in Lancaster
EcoWatch's solar experts analyzed each solar company in Lancaster based on criteria such as its reputation in the industry, customer reviews, services, warranty coverage and financing. Using this solar methodology, we used the data we collected to rate and rank each company and narrow down our picks for the best solar companies in Lancaster
Below are some the criteria we examined specifically for Ohio solar companies
- Brand reputation and certifications (20%): We take each company's Better Business Bureau (BBB) score into consideration, as well as how long the installer has been in business (at least 5 years is required, 10 preferred) and what type of solar certifications it holds.
- Customer reviews (20%): Trust is a top priority at EcoWatch, so we take customer experience under close consideration. We scour different review sites and customer testimonials when ranking our top solar companies, checking sites such as Trustpilot and Google Reviews. We also consider any potential complaints or lawsuits filed against these companies and award or remove points accordingly.
- Warranty (20%): A company earns a perfect score in this category if it offers 25-year warranties that cover performance, product and workmanship. The industry standard that we measure companies against is 25-year product and performance warranties, along with a 10-year workmanship warranty. We also look closely into the track record of the post-installation support each company provides in terms of honoring its contracts
- Solar services (10%): All of the companies we review install solar panels, but we award companies higher points if they offer additional services for customers, like battery installation, energy-efficiency audits, and EV chargers.
- Pricing and financing (10%): It's hard to get exact quotes for solar projects, but we use marketplace research to determine how each company prices its equipment and installation services. Additionally, companies that offer more help for panel financing — like in-house loans, leases, or PPAs — score higher than those that don't.
- Availability (10%): The bigger the service area, the higher the company will score.
- Transparency and accessibility (5%): Solar installers that offer free consultations and easy contact methods score higher in this category.
- Environmental, social and corporate governance factors (5%): A company earns a perfect score in this category if it offers public data disclosure, addresses end-of-life (EOL) products or processes, and demonstrates a commitment to uplifting the communities that it serves.
The Cost and Benefits of Solar in Lancaster
When deciding on a solar company, most homeowners or business owners wonder about the costs the most.The overall price and potential savings vary depending on some key factors such as:
- The cost of electricity in your area: If your local energy rates are quite high, there's a better chance you'll get a higher return on your investment in a solar panel system. In Lancaster, you can save an average of $1,332 a month on your electricity bills.
- Electricity consumption: The average household in Lancaster uses a decent amount of, and as a result may save on their energy bills.
- Your home's orientation toward the sun: This, along with how your roof is set up, affects affect how much energy your solar panels can make.
- Choice of solar panels: The type of solar panels you need will affect your total cost. High-efficiency monocrystalline panels will cost more upfront but can also lead to more savings over the lifetime of your system. If space isn't a constraint for your project, you can go with a higher number of more affordable panels.
So is a solar system worth it? Whether you hope to lower your electricity costs, greenhouse gas emissions or both, solar panels are a solid investment for many Lancaster homeowners.

What are the advantages and disadvantages of solar power?
A few of the biggest pros are that it reduces your power bills, it’s environmentally friendly, and it can give you a decent return on your investment (ROI). The most notable cons are that solar panels don’t produce electricity at night, there is a high upfront cost and solar panels aren’t always aesthetically pleasing.
Are solar panels worth it?
Solar panels require a significant upfront investment that costs over ten thousand dollars, but whether or not solar panels are worth it depends on a range of factors like the cost of electricity near you and how much direct sunlight your roof gets.
What are the different types of solar panels?
The different types of solar panels are monocrystalline, polycrystalline and thin-film. Monocrystalline panels are more efficient but also more costly. Polycrystalline panels cost less but also less efficient than monocrystalline. Thin-film solar panels are flexible, so they can be used where the other types can’t, like on curved surfaces or cars, but they are also less efficient. The best one for you depends on your budget, the layout of your roof and how much efficiency you're looking for.
